Historic James Bradley House--circa 1851--ideally located in Portland West End. This tastefully renovated home offers flexible living with 3+ bedrooms and 2.5 baths, including the convenience of one-level living with a first-floor bedroom, a beautifully updated full bath with soaking tub, and a washer and dryer thoughtfully located on the main level. The home has been extensively improved with added insulation, a new roof, updated windows, electrical upgrades, a newer boiler, and five heat pumps installed throughout to maintain comfortable, energy-efficient temperatures year-round--seamlessly blending original period charm with modern updates. The first floor also features new flooring, a welcoming living room with a cozy wood-burning fireplace, and a versatile den with a custom bar--perfect for entertaining or relaxing. The spacious, updated kitchen includes a dining area, butcher block island, quartz countertops, and a pantry for added storage, with access to both front and rear staircases. Upstairs offers exceptional flexibility with multiple rooms currently used as a bedroom, home office with custom built-ins, home gym, and additional bonus space, along with a full bath and half bath. Enjoy a private patio, off-street parking, and an EV charger--offering truly move-in ready urban living in one of Portland's most desirable neighborhoods.

R6
Residential
To set aside areas on the peninsula for housing characterized primarily by multi-family dwellings at a high density providing a wide range of housing for differing types of households; to conserve the existing housing stock and residential character of neighborhoods by controlling the scale and external impacts of professional offices and other nonresidential uses; and to encourage new housing development consistent with the compact lot development pattern typically found on the peninsula.
